Although I'm not able to attend, I have a piece in Midnight Snack, an art show curated by Sarah Lazarovic, at the Beaver (1192 Queen Street West). The show opening is this Saturday, September 30, 2006, at 7pm. My piece is entitled Uncle Paully wants a Sausage. It's an unframed photographic print that measures 16"x20". ¶ Recently I've been spending hours a day designing the new Siteway sites (Siteway and the family of art brands therein: Tonicville, Phelts, and a surprise...) for an all-encompassing launch in 2007. Antony Hare is a freelance illustrator whose work has appeared in publications including B.C. Business, Chatelaine, Esquire UK, Maisonneuve, Forbes, Seattle Metropolitan, Town & Country, Bon Appétit, and National Post (for which he won a Silver Medal from the Society of News Design). His work is at the meeting point between portraiture and caricature. Antony is a member of the Society of Illustrators and works from his office in downtown Toronto. ¶ Learn more about Antony.


Siteway was launched in 1996. It is Antony Hare's personal web site and is affiliated only with him. It contains his gallery of illustrations and blog since 2000.
